  The newborn can see the difference betweenvarious shapes and patterns from birth. He preferspatterns to dull or bright solid colors and lookslonger at stripes and angles than at circularpatterns. Within three weeks, however, his preference shifts dramatically to the human face.

  Why should a baby with so little visual experience attend more to a human face than to anyother kind of pattern’? Some scientists think this preference represents a built in advantagefor the human species. The object of prime importance to the physically helpless infant is ahuman being. Babies seem to have a natural tendency to the human face as potentiallyrewarding. Researchers also point out that the newborn wisely relies more on pattern than onoutline, size, or color. Pattern remains stable, while outline changes with point of view; size,with distance from an object; and brightness and color, with lighting.

  Mothers have always claimed that they could see their newborns looking at them as theyheld them, despite what they have been told. The experts who thought that perception (知覺)had to await physical development and the consequence of action were wrong for severalreasons. Earlier research techniques were less sophisticated than they are today. Physical skillswere once used to indicate perception of objects-skills like visual tracking and reaching for anobject, both of which the newborn does poorly. Then, too, assumptions that the newborn’s eyeand brain were too immature for anything as sophisticated as pattern recognition causedopposing data to be thrown away. Since perception of form was widely believed to followperception of more “basic” qualities such as color and brightness, the possibility of itspresence from birth was rejected.
